I have worked with children, teens, and adults in a therapeutic fashion for most of my adult life.  Experiencing safe, nurturing relationships and clear, loving boundaries during every stage of life is critical to giving and receiving love in healthy ways and adapting to the changes that come with each stage of the life cycle. 

I have specific training in trauma, attachment and dialectical approaches. I am certified in Dialectical Behavioral Therapy (DBT), an evidence-based approach that works well for mood disorders, conduct disorders, PTSD, borderline personality disorder and trauma.  I devote many hours each week to reading, skills development, and professional collaboration in order to stay current with evidenced-based practices and research, reflect on my own skills, and grow personally and professionally. This is what my clients deserve.

I refer out the following challenges to clinicians who are specially trained:
  • Drug and alcohol dependency, misuse or abuse
  • Eating disorders/disordered eating and advanced body image issues
  • Advanced dissociative disorders (large lapses in memory, frequent losses of time with dangerous or detrimental outcomes, multiple parts that are unaware of each other, parts that are violent or dangerous to self or others and are non-responsive to therapeutic interventions or coping strategies)
